Sliding Door Track Repair in Conroe, TX
Sliding door track repair services address issues related to the tracks that allow sliding doors to open and close smoothly. This service covers a variety of projects, including fixing misaligned or damaged tracks, replacing worn-out rollers, and realigning doors that stick or slide unevenly. Homeowners often seek this service when their sliding doors become difficult to operate, noisy, or if the door has come off its track, ensuring that the door functions properly and maintains its appearance.
Before requesting sliding door track repair,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the damage or misalignment, the compatibility of replacement parts, and whether the repair will restore the door’s smooth operation. It’s also helpful to consider the type of sliding door, such as glass, screen, or wood, and any specific features like security locks or weather stripping that might influence the repair process. Clear information about these factors can assist in planning for a successful and efficient repair.

Sliding Door Track Repair Questions
What causes sliding door tracks to need repair? Common issues include misalignment, debris buildup, or track warping, which can hinder smooth operation.
How can I tell if my sliding door track needs repair? Difficulty opening or closing the door, unusual noises, or visible damage are signs that repair may be necessary.
What types of sliding doors are serviced? Repairs typically cover patio, closet, or shower sliding doors with track systems that require maintenance or replacement.
Is track repair a DIY project? While some minor adjustments are possible, professional repair ensures proper alignment and function for safety and durability.
